Caddo Sheriff Steve Prator says he is very disappointed with the decision by the Caddo Parish Commission not to approve a proclamation declaring January 9 as "National Law Enforcement Day" in Caddo Parish. He did not even realize Commissioner Mario Chavez was going to present the proclamation to his colleagues.

But once the group voted it down 6-5 along party lines, the Sheriff says his deputies began calling to ask why the Commission would turn down this measure. He says that is the wrong message to send to law enforcement officers right now.
